A bookstore had 45 copies of a magazine. Yesterday, it sold 13 of them. Today, it sold 23 of what remained. How many copies does
the bookstore have left?
1 answer:
Answer:
9
Step-by-step explanation:
Total initially in bookstore = 45
Sold 13copies, remaining copies = 45-13= 32
Sold 23 copies again, remaining copies = 32-23 = 9
Copies left = 9
